Transaction f50334fb73129fcf0a52e64622d25e73855d41e00f4bdfd7ae40e383aa199623
1 Input
1 Output
-
f50334fb73129fcf0a52e64622d25e73855d41e00f4bdfd7ae40e383aa199623:0
- value
- 148640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2952b8d5d1e0c22078d830e415308dff39f34a6a OP_EQUAL
- address
- 35TWj2yzqTWpDVWBd37S6QxkaLHNRsP4mt